On Tuesday, his Majesty attended the House of Peers in state, accompanied by the Duke of Dorset and the Earl of Hyndford, and granted royal assent to five Acts concerning lottery funding, corn and flour duties, export prohibitions from American colonies, mutiny punishment, and military recruiting.

Outcome
royal assent given to five acts: lottery funding, discontinuation of duties on imported corn and flour, prohibition on exportation of victuals from american colonies with exceptions, permission for neutral ship imports and isle of man exports, punishment for mutiny and desertion with better army payment, and recruiting of land forces and marines.
Event Details
His Majesty went to the House of Peers with usual state, attended by the Duke of Dorset and Earl of Hyndford in the state coach, and assented to the listed Acts.
